<p>A <b>continental margin</b> is the outer edge of <a href="page.php?w=continental_crust">continental crust</a> abutting <a href="page.php?w=oceanic_crust">oceanic crust</a> under <a href="page.php?w=coastal_water">coastal water</a>s. The continental margin consists of three different features: the <a href="page.php?w=continental_rise">continental rise</a>, the <b>continental slope</b>, and the <a href="page.php?w=continental_shelf">continental shelf</a>.
